Book Description

Health Learning Handbook June 1, 2001
Deficiencies of calcium, the most abundant mineral in the body, are linked to a number of health problems including high blood pressure, cancer of the colon, cancer of the breast, osteoporosis and atherosclerosis.

Calcium is also important for our thyroid, immune system, energy production and for cellular maintenance,

Fossilized Coral is an excellent source of usable calcium for the body. Fossilized Coral actually contains over 70 different minerals and trace minerals (all which are needed by the body), calcium is in the highest concentration.

Find out what other important cofactors you need in addition to calcium to make it work optimally in the body for you to prevent health problems and aid many problems you may have.

About the Author

About the Author Beth M. Ley, Ph.D., has been a science writer specializing in health and nutrition since 1988 and has written many health- related books, including the best sellers, DHEA: Unlocking the Secrets to the Fountain of Youth and MSM: On Our Way Back to Health With Sulfur. She wrote her own undergraduate degree program and graduated in Scientific and Technical Writing from North Dakota State University in 1987 (combination of Zoology and Journalism). Beth has her masters (1998) and doctoral degrees (1999) in Nutrition from Clayton College of Nutrition.

Beth does nutrition and wellness counseling and speaks on nutrition, health and divine healing locally and nationwide.
